Have you ever surprised yourself with a reaction you thought was behind you? Maybe you snapped, shut down, fell into an old pattern, or ran back to what God already pulled you from. You're not alone. In this powerful and transparent episode, Minister Demetria Lea breaks down the spiritual blueprint behind our reactions—revealing how the enemy doesn’t attack randomly, but strategically. He studies your patterns, exploits your past pain, and whispers lies that hit where you're still healing. But thank God—there’s a way out. Together, we explore the emotional and spiritual war that begins in the mind, the importance of discernment, and how to take our thoughts captive before they become cycles. Through the lives of lesser-known biblical characters like Gehazi, Jonah, Jehoram, and Diotrephes, we uncover how being triggered isn’t a disqualification—it’s a signal to realign. This episode is your reminder that one bad reaction doesn’t define you. But what you do next—repentance—can set you free.
